Martha Finley





Elsie, young and motherless, has never met her father and is being raised by her father's family. As a strong Christian, she has many trials within the unbelieving family. Her greatest comforts are her faith and her mammy, Chloe. Finally, her father returns home. Will her father love her? Will her father learn to love Jesus? (Summary by Tricia G)

Warning!! Disturbing Story.
Annika Matson





It's pretty disturbing how this story normalizes abuse. Whipping, shaming, restricting food, and withholding love are all portrayed as acceptable forms of discipline. Elsie's father goes from being harsh and cruel to overly affectionate and back again without any warning. He treats his youngest brother, a mischievous, somewhat poorly behaved, but mostly normal boy of ten, terrifyingly. I found myself worried many times for Elsie when she is in the company of one of her father's friends: a man of at least twenty-five who cannot keep his hands or eyes off her. He is apparently a good, upright man according to the story, but is, at least in my mind, dangerous and creepy. I would not encourage young children/ less mature readers to listen to this. Proceed with caution.
